Another date has been added to the Live at the Marquee line-up in Cork next summer, and it’s one that sells out every year.

Christy Moore’s return to the tent has been confirmed. It follows the release of a new song inspired by the Leeside festival, which Moore has performed annually since it began in 2005.

He will play Live at the Marquee Cork on Saturday, June 28. Tickets will go on sale on Thursday, October 31 at 9am from ticketmaster.ie.

Moore’s new album, A Terrible Beauty, will be released on November 1 and the latest single from this album ‘The Big Marquee’ was released earlier this week after first being played on the Two Norries Podcast last year. It includes the lyrics: “On the Banks of the River Lee / Saturday night we’re packed in tight / All together in The Big Marquee.” 

Moore recently sold out 12 nights at Vicar Street, which will take place across this November, December and January.

Other acts confirmed for Live at the Marquee next year include The Waterboys, Tommy Tiernan, Olly Murs, The Coronas, and a trio of Rory Gallagher tribute gigs, led by Joe Bonamassa.
